Использование CODESYS в панелях Weintek

Описание к видео Использование CODESYS в панелях Weintek

ООО "Русавтоматика" (http://www.rusavtomatika.com) представляет: Использование CODESYS в панелях Weintek.
В этом видео мы хотим показать, какие шаги нужно предпринять для начала
работы с новыми панелями Weintek, поддерживающими среду разработки CODESYS.

Ссылки, которые упоминаются в видео:
- Стоимость лицензии CODESYS Runtime http://www.rusavtomatika.com/accessor...
- Актуальная версия среды разработки CODESYS https://store.codesys.com/codesys.html
- Руководство пользователя CODESYS на русском языке https://drive.google.com/open?id=1ZrS...
- Раздел для скачивания актуальных файлов FilesForCODESYS.zip и EasyRemoteIO_V12013.zip http://www.rusavtomatika.com/download...
- Таргет-файл для работы модулем Weintek в среде CODESYS http://www.rusavtomatika.com/soft/EBP...
- Приложение EasyRemoteIO для настройки IP-адреса каплера Weintek http://www.rusavtomatika.com/soft/EBP...

На апрель 2019 года CoDeSys доступен в моделях:
cMT3071, cMT3072, cMT3090, cMT3151
Актуальный список моделей вы можете найти на сайте:
http://www.rusavtomatika.com/search/?...

Панели cMT3071, cMT3072, cMT3090, cMT3151 (список актуален на апр.2019) имеют встроенный контроллер,
программируемый в соответсвии со стандартом IEC 61131-3 средой разработки CODESYS v3.5.
В панелях установлен двухъядерный процессор, который управляет двумя независимыми операционными системами.

Активация CODESYS в панелях Weintek
Для работы с CODESYS, необходимо приобрести карту активации.
Стоимость лицензии CODESYS Runtime можно узнать на сайте:
www.rusavtomatika.com/accessories/license/codesys/

Действие лицензии распространяется на одну панель на весь период её использования.
Для приобретения лицензии, обратитесь к официальному дистрибьютору продукции Weintek на территории России
компании «Русавтоматика» http://www.rusavtomatika.com/

Войдите в системные настройки панели (кнопка входа находится в левом верхнем углу).
В системных настройках введите ключ активации расположенный на обратной стороне карты.
После активации у вас появляется полноценный ПЛК, к которому вы можете подключить новые модули ввода-вывода от компании Weintek, данные коммуникационные устройства поддерживают шины CAN bus или Modbus TCP, а также любые другие устройства поддерживающие эти два протокола.

Далее для работы понадобится среда разработки CODESYS (версия 3.5 и выше)
Для того, чтобы в среде разработки CoDeSys мы могли работать с контроллером Weintek, нам понадобится Target-файл.
В Target-файлах содержится информация о ресурсах программируемых контроллеров, с которыми работает CoDeSys.
Target-файлы поставляются производителем контроллера.
Скачиваем архив FilesForCODESYS.zip, в котором содержится target файл Weintek_CODESYS_and_RemoteIO_1.0.0.95.package
и подключаем его в программу CODESYS.
Также скачайте программу EasyRemoteIO_V12013.zip, она понадобится позже для настройки модулей ввода вывода.

Создаем стандартный проект.
Появилось новое устройство Weintek Built-in CODESYS. Выбираем его.

Устанавливаем соединение с нашим ПЛК, находящимся внутри панели Weintek.
Для этого просканируем сеть и выберем наш контроллер.
Зеленый индикатор означает,что связь с ПЛК установлена.

Следующим шагом добавляем устройство - коммуникационный модуль (каплер) Weintek iR-ETN, с подключенными к нему модулями: дискретный модуль ввода-вывода Weintek iR-DQ8-R, аналоговый модуль ввода-вывода Weintek iR-AI04-VI, температурный модуль ввода-вывода Weintek iR-AI04-TR

Настраиваем IP адрес нашего контроллера.
Выбираем автоподключение.
Устанавливаем IP адрес ведомого уствойства.
Адрес каплера Weintek сканируется и настраивается через программу EasyRemoteIO.

Для демонстрации работы ПЛК в панели Weintek, напишем небольшую программу, которую потом загрузим в ПЛК.
Добавляем Modbus каналы нашего каплера, в той последовательности в которой подключены модули к нему.
8 дискретных выходов и 8 аналоговых входов.
Соотнесем переменные с тэгами нашей программы.
Добавляем новый объект Символьная конфигурация и компилируем программу.
В папке с программой лежат скомпилированные файлы.
Открываем EasyBuilder, выбираем нужную модель панели и устройство Weintek Built-in CODESYS.
Импортируем тэги с нашего проекта.
В EasyBuilder Pro мы cоздали демонстрационную программу. Загрузим ее в панель и проверим работу всех компонентов в целом.

Комментарии

Информация по комментариям в разработке